Songs of Conquest is a turn-based strategy game where you lead powerful magicians called Wielders and venture to lands unknown. Wage battles against armies that dare oppose you, hunt for powerful artifacts and expand your territory. The world is ripe for the taking – seize it!
Explore a wide variety of maps with diverse enemies and valuable loot. Delve into contrasting biomes with unique factions, environments and battlefields.
Manage resources, research new advancements and expand your kingdom. Plan your towns to match your playstyle – Will you enlist every archer you can to rain death from their bows, or will the eternal legions of Aurelia march to war beneath your banners?
Dive into a deep combat system using troop abilities and powerful magic. Combine troops to maximize available spells and damage potential. March into epic siege battles and determine which faction matches your playstyle and strategy. There are many ways to conquer!
Handcrafted maps for the curious adventurer, or randomized maps for endless replayability. Conquest maps allow head-to-head battles, while Challenge maps offer strategic puzzles to hone your tactical thinking. Find a plethora of maps created by the Lavapotion team as well as our mod community.
Venture into the world of Aerbor on your own, team up with a friend, or enlist AI allies and enemies - the choice is yours. The majority of maps are playable in single player, co-op, or multiplayer through local hotseat or online.
Four factions are locked in an epic conflict. Arleon, knights of old battling each other for dominance. Rana, ancient tribes fighting for survival in the swamp. Loth, necromancers raising the dead to create a glorious future. Barya, bold mercenaries and inventors dedicated to coin, gunpowder and independence.
Listen to the bards as they celebrate your path to victory. Each campaign comes with a unique song that tells the tale of your rise and ruin. Unlock new verses as you complete missions, enjoying the full track at the end of the journey.
The in-game map editor allows you to create your own adventures using the same tools the developers use to create campaign and skirmish maps. Script in-game events, control the soundtrack, write dialogue and share your creations with others!

[b]Songs of Conquest[/b] is a modern version of the classic [i]Heroes of Might and Magic[/i]. While the gameplay loop is familiar – heroes build armies, scour the map for treasure, resources and artifacts, then conquer opponents or capture waypoints - [b]Conquest[/b] is more than just a nostalgic game with similar mechanics. Lavapotion’s focus on gameplay, characters, unit designs, map layout, beautiful music and a 2.5D pixel art style, have created a world rich in story and variety that’s unique to the genre. Upon launching the game, you have a number of modes to choose from… [u]Campaigns & Tales[/u] are relatively short narrative driven stories designed primarily as a tutorial to familiarize the player with each faction. [u]Conquest[/u] maps offer dozens of handcrafted maps, some very challenging [u]Puzzle[/u] maps, and [u]Random[/u] “template” maps for endless replayability. [u]Community[/u] maps are accessible through a third-party (Mod.io), which is highly questionable because of their required automatic account creation ([i]no, thank you[/i]), and sketchy history. Why not use Steam Workshop for a simple “map”, I don’t know, but if you are very curious about seeing what other players have created you can download them manually([b]*[/b]) without any login and simply save the file in the appropriate location. [b]*[/b] Many of these community maps and campaigns are very creative, adding plenty of replay value to the game, so I do recommend trying them out. [u]Multiplayer[/u] offers a number of choices to connect with other players, including a hotseat option so you can play as multiple factions on a map. The [u]Map Editor[/u] lets you build your own map or campaign. I used this to help with unlocking a couple of the “grindy” steam achievements. Factions are unique both in thematic flavor and unit design. While they each have melee/range fighters, no single unit is completely identical. While some share a similar primary mechanic, like burrowing underground or dashing across the battlefield, their secondary ability is completely different. The number of units each Wielder can carry is also capped, which eliminates the need to micromanage huge armies. It quickly becomes apparent that some units are "better" than others but each one has their pros and cons so no single unit type is really overpowering. Magic, on the other hand, can seem OP and adds to the strategic layer of the game. Spells can buff your relatively weak army and win against larger enemy forces using de-buffs and field control while also shooting the occasional direct-damage spells. Magic essence is generated from each unit, as well as other things like artifacts and upgrades, so for the most part it’s not something you need to build your army around since every Wielder from each faction uses the same list of magic spells. Wielders, of course, are unique heroes who all have different specialties that buff certain units or abilities. Everyone chooses random skills as they upgrade but some will lean more toward Magic skills while others will see more Combat skills to pick from. The myriad of artifacts in the game also adds to the countless variety of upgrades a Wielder can have. However, because of the sheer volume of artifacts, it can be cumbersome organizing them among your heroes given how your characters’ inventory has no sorting function. Beyond these basics, [b]Conquest[/b] gives the player a lot of control over the different variables you can adjust on a map from starting resources, to number of Wielders, enemy growth rate, field-of-view size and more. Combined with adjusting A.I. difficulty, color, faction and teams - there is so much you can experiment with. It’s clear Lavapotion were heavily inspired by [i]HoMM[/i]. [b]Songs of Conquest[/b] is a simple game with a design philosophy that's straight-to-the-point, well crafted, well balanced, and story-rich with enough variety and choices for hours of fun, leaving plenty of room for the game to grow.
